How they compare
China, mainland currently reports 20,311 kg/ha against 18,455 kg/ha in Asia, a difference of 1,856 kg/ha.
That makes China, mainland's figure about 1.1 times Asia's.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 64 shared years of data; in 1961 it was China, mainland ahead.
Asia ranks 4th and China, mainland ranks 8th of 10 regions.
Across the 7 decades both report, Asia averaged higher in 4 and China, mainland in 3.

Crop and livestock statistics are recorded for 278 products, covering the following categories: 1) CROPS PRIMARY: Cereals, Citrus Fruit, Fibre Crops, Fruit, Oil Crops, Oil Crops and Cakes in Oil Equivalent, Pulses, Roots and Tubers, Sugar Crops, Treenuts and Vegetables. Data are expressed in terms of area harvested, production quantity and yield. Cereals: Area and production data on cereals relate to crops harvested for dry grain only.
